A method of selecting a monoclonal cell colony (18) that secretes a product of interest is described. The method comprises providing a plurality of cell culture spaces (10). Each cell culture space (10) has a respective assessment surface (14). Each assessment surface (14) is provided with a first binding agent (20, 30, 42) that is immobilised on the assessment surface (14). A suspension of cells is plated in the plurality of cell culture spaces (10) so that at least some of the cell culture spaces (10) are plated with a single viable cell. The cells are incubated in a growth medium (16) in the cell culture spaces (10) to cause replication of the cells. At least some of the cells secrete a product of interest (22, 32, 44). A second binding agent (24, 34, 46) is provided in the cell culture spaces (10). At least initially, the second binding agent (24, 34, 46) is not immobilised. Each of the first and second binding agents binds to the product of interest (22, 32, 44) so that secretion of the product of interest by cells in any one of the cell culture spaces (10) leads to a complex comprising the first binding agent (20, 30, 42), the product of interest (22, 32, 44) and the second binding agent (24, 34, 46) forming at the corresponding assessment surface (14) of the cell culture space (10). The method also includes assessing at least some of the cell culture spaces (10) for presence of the second binding agent at the assessment surface (14) of the cell culture space. The method further includes determining for at least some of the cell culture spaces whether the cell culture space contains a single cell colony that is derived from a single cell. A cell culture space is selected using the assessment and the determination. The selected cell culture space contains a single monoclonal cell colony which secretes the product of interest. |
